What I do here at Father Natures

What I do at Father Natures is very simple. I find forever, loving homes for as many ferrets as possible. We make sure that every ferret that enters our doors receives the best medical care my resources can provide. They get the best high protein foods, cool clean water and the occasional treat, well, sometimes more than just occasionally.

I provide love, safety and an enriched life for all the little fuzzies in my care whether they are here for a short time or for the rest of their days. No ferret is ever put down at Father Natures unless it is due to unmanageable pain. We feel that these neglected and sometimes abused creatures deserve a life full of the same enjoyment they provide for us.

My life has been touched by these bundles of energy and I cannot imagine a world without them. If you are considering adoption please do your homework to make sure a ferret is right for you. Ferrets do not make great gifts for adults let alone children. so please do not contact me if this is your intention. The State of New Jersey requires ALL, ferret care givers, to possess a permit. You will recieve a 20 day temporary permit from the rescue and I will instruct you on filling out the required paperwork and where to send it along with the annual $10.00 fee. This annual fee is for one or multiple carpet sharks, not each ferret. This permit MUST be signed by an adult 18 years or older and we do not adopt to those under the age of eighteen so please bring an adult along.
